So my car is currently being fixed right now because of some idiot who didn't take care of his car obviously. I was driving home a few nights ago and I happened to be behind the pizza guy, and something flew off the bottom of the car (it looked like a muffler or something like that) and I tried to swerve to miss the object but I still hit it...and it bounced all the way down the bottom of my car. Turns out it messed up my exhaust somehow and the damages are around $600 dollars because of someone else's carelessness. I just wondered if there was anything I could do? I know the model of the car and where the person works who lost the car part...Is there someway to make the person who caused the damages pay for what his carelessness did to my car. I am also a college student and I can NOT afford to pay for damages like this, and it is really aggravating so if anyone knows anything I can do that would be great! Thanks!!!!

what exactly happened to your exhaust system that requires an entire replacement? There is a heat patch tape you can use for punctures that might be annoying to have to keep replacing, but it will buy you lots of time and get you more shelflife out of the existing exhaust system. If only the cat is damaged, you can replace just that, or have a welder replace just the sections that are damaged. If this is an old car, your exhaust system may have been due for replacement- in which case its not really a loss, but a diminished shelf life. tell us more, maybe others will have ideas. |

Check to see if you have a 'road hazard' clause in your policy and call that adjuster.
Speak to the owner of "Shakey's Pizza'...they just might carry liability on their drivers... Keep good notes on this and create a file. Wv coal trucks are notorius for breaking windshields and the better companies replace them without hassle...I bet you have recourse from this because of the potential court action of having the police cite the driver for creating a hazard on the roadway. These new japanese cars come with a stainless steel exhaust and to replace it with original replacement parts would certainly be in the range of price you described. However...a regular system of chinese pipe could be installed for about $150 on a good day at Midas or Jacks Friendly... something that would carry a lifetime warrantee... think about this, as a compromise may be the solution to a new exhaust... and how old was your car? |
